Transaction 145057af4fdce18a831a29968f4e643c86b09149a9c56e3464e536c87e91bc67

2 Input
2 Outputs
  • 145057af4fdce18a831a29968f4e643c86b09149a9c56e3464e536c87e91bc67:0
  • value  170000000
    address  1FpggU2vU5ic68XSSLKYofujKcMuqVJXzx
  • 145057af4fdce18a831a29968f4e643c86b09149a9c56e3464e536c87e91bc67:1
  • value  40747
    address  1DJFQvYZfSjdZTCfJVdJStXCkWviJomRCX